FitSwap: Fitness Gear Marketplace

Introducing "FitSwap," a marketplace app that connects individuals looking to trade or rent fitness equipment and gear. This platform addresses the issue of high costs and space constraints for fitness enthusiasts by allowing them to access a wider variety of equipment affordably. Targeting budget-conscious millennials and those in urban areas with limited storage, FitSwap stands out with its community-driven approach, incorporating a social element that encourages users to share tips, experiences, and workout challenges while fostering a sense of belonging.

Competition Analysis

Score: 65/100

Several platforms offer fitness equipment rentals or sales, but few focus on peer-to-peer trading and community engagement.

Gympass

Access to multiple gyms and studios via subscription.

Strengths: Established brand, Wide network

Weaknesses: Limited to gyms, not equipment

Spinlister

Rent sports equipment including bikes and surfboards.

Strengths: Niche focus, Community-driven

Weaknesses: Limited to specific sports
